Subject: [PATCH 3/7] clk: sunxi: Use common of_clk_init() function

Use common of_clk_init() function to initialize clocks.

Signed-off-by: Prashant Gaikwad <pgaikwad@...dia.com>
---
 drivers/clk/clk-sunxi.c           |   30 ------------------------------
 drivers/clocksource/sunxi_timer.c |    4 ++--
 include/linux/clk/sunxi.h         |   22 ----------------------
 3 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 54 deletions(-)
 delete mode 100644 drivers/clk/clk-sunxi.c
 delete mode 100644 include/linux/clk/sunxi.h

diff --git a/drivers/clk/clk-sunxi.c b/drivers/clk/clk-sunxi.c
deleted file mode 100644
index 0e831b5..0000000
--- a/drivers/clk/clk-sunxi.c
+++ /dev/null
@@ -1,30 +0,0 @@
-/*
- * Copyright 2012 Maxime Ripard
- *
- * Maxime Ripard <maxime.ripard@...e-electrons.com>
- *
- *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
- * it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
- * the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the License, or
- * (at your option) any later version.
- *
- * This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
- *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
- *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the
- * GNU General Public License for more details.
- */
-
-#include <linux/clk-provider.h>
-#include <linux/clkdev.h>
-#include <linux/clk/sunxi.h>
-#include <linux/of.h>
-
-static const __initconst struct of_device_id clk_match[] = {
-	{ .compatible = "fixed-clock", .data = of_fixed_clk_setup, },
-	{}
-};
-
-void __init sunxi_init_clocks(void)
-{
-	of_clk_init(clk_match);
-}
diff --git a/drivers/clocksource/sunxi_timer.c b/drivers/clocksource/sunxi_timer.c
index 6c2ed56..08e1756 100644
--- a/drivers/clocksource/sunxi_timer.c
+++ b/drivers/clocksource/sunxi_timer.c
@@ -23,7 +23,7 @@
 #include <linux/of_address.h>
 #include <linux/of_irq.h>
 #include <linux/sunxi_timer.h>
-#include <linux/clk/sunxi.h>
+#include <linux/clk-provider.h>
 
 #define TIMER_CTL_REG		0x00
 #define TIMER_CTL_ENABLE		(1 << 0)
@@ -124,7 +124,7 @@ void __init sunxi_timer_init(void)
 	if (irq <= 0)
 		panic("Can't parse IRQ");
 
-	sunxi_init_clocks();
+	of_clk_init(NULL);
 
 	clk = of_clk_get(node, 0);
 	if (IS_ERR(clk))
diff --git a/include/linux/clk/sunxi.h b/include/linux/clk/sunxi.h
deleted file mode 100644
index e074fdd..0000000
--- a/include/linux/clk/sunxi.h
+++ /dev/null
@@ -1,22 +0,0 @@
-/*
- * Copyright 2012 Maxime Ripard
- *
- * Maxime Ripard <maxime.ripard@...e-electrons.com>
- *
- *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
- * it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
- * the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the License, or
- * (at your option) any later version.
- *
- * This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
- *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
- *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the
- * GNU General Public License for more details.
- */
-
-#ifndef __LINUX_CLK_SUNXI_H_
-#define __LINUX_CLK_SUNXI_H_
-
-void __init sunxi_init_clocks(void);
-
-#endif
